WebThe bluefin trevally, Caranx melampygus (also known as the bluefin jack, bluefin kingfish, bluefinned crevalle, blue ulua, omilu and spotted trevally), is a species of large, widely distributed marine fish classified in the jack family, Carangidae. The bluefin trevally is distributed throughout the tropical waters of the Indian and Pacific ...

WebApr 1, 2024 · Of the large trevally family, the most well-known is the Giant Trevally. It is found throughout the Indo-Pacific region and will grow up to 170 cm and weight at least 35 kg. The giant trevally (Caranx ignobilis) is normally a silvery colour with occasional dark spots, but males may turn a darker silver or even black once they mature. WebAs an insurance policy, use a metre or so of 10-15kg fluorocarbon trace tied directly to your main line with an Albright or double Uni knot. One of the big tips for successful trevally fishing is to keep your hook size down. I use hooks no larger than 4/0, going right down to 1/0 when using very small baits or when the fish are cautious. WebThe bigeye trevally is one of the larger members of Caranx, growing to a maximum recorded size of 120 cm in length and 18.0 kg in weight. It is similar to most other jacks in having a compressed, oblong body, with the dorsal profile slightly more than the ventral profile, particularly anteriorly. WebSep 11, 2024 · Giant trevally ( Caranx ignobilis) is also known as giant kingfish, barrier trevally, lowly trevally, ulua (in Hawaii) or GT for short. GTs have an average length of 85cm – specimens of around 60cm will be 3 – 4 years old and those over 1m in length will be roughly 8 – 10 years old.
